Howdy, in an attempt to draw more attention at my local venues I am converting LOTR forces by GW. Yes these are movie LOTR.

Will be Rohan vs urukhai and have a wizard based on each for potential fantasy port.

For Rohan I figure an easy force to foil into the urukhai using the models I have would be all mounted knights and jav cav and horse bow. So that's an easy 12 bases with only 3-4 unit types.

For the urukhai a large like block and then heavy foot and cross bow or raiders. This gives a slower but larger force to Rohan with higher combat values but can be shattered by the knights.

Again we are going for ease of teaching and movie thematic coolness to grab folks

The Urukhai from the films looked more like a combination of pike and raider to me. This would make for an interesting game since the pike would be strong against cavalry, but the raiders would be vulnerable in the open.

(On a side note, I still cringe every time I watch the movie and see cavalry charging downhill into a pike block...)

I wouldn't tie yourself too much to the pike designation. Did they really fight like Pikemen in the movie? You have lots to choose from in terms of troop types.

The hardest thing to work out is the basing with the large round basing of the mounted figures, assuming you are not going to rebase. I did some custom basing back in the day that had 6 foot and 2 mounted figures per base that worked pretty well.

You might want to recharacterize your game in terms of it not being the assualt at Helms deep, but the battle of the arrival of the reinforcements/rescue troops.
